Applications in mobile ad hoc network are growing rapidly. But these applications have maximum utility only when mobiles can be used anywhere at anytime. However, One of the greatest limitations of such networks, is finite power of batteries. In order, to maximize the battery life of the nodes, we must minimize their energy consumption. The energy can be managed in various levels. Here, we propose an implementable energy-saving initialization protocol. It is the result of a combination of an average case analysis and a randomized approach to initialize ad hoc networks. Its implementation shows an effective gain in terms of energy saving.
